Production History

The Best Kept Secret of World War II had one fully staged production, directed by Harland Meltzer, at the Westerly Theatre in Westerly, Rhode Island. That production was taken "on the road" to Kingswood-Oxford School in West Hartford, CT, and then to the Choate Rosemary School in Wallingford, CT.

A west coast production with four performances took place at Sprague High School in Salem, Oregon.
